Paquet : libasync-interrupt-perl (1.26-1 et autres) [debports]
Liens pour libasync-interrupt-perl
Ressources Debian :
Télécharger le paquet source :
IntrouvableResponsables :
Ressources externes :
- Page d'accueil [metacpan.org]
Paquets similaires :
module pour permettre aux bibliothèques C/XS d'interrompre Perl
Async::Interrupt est un module Perl qui implémente des interruptions asynchrones, de même nature que les signaux UNIX, de façon multi-plateforme. Des modules pourraient vouloir exécuter du code de façon asynchrone (dans un autre processus léger ou à partir d'un gestionnaire de signal) et envoyer ensuite un signal à l'interpréteur lors de certains événements. Une manière courante de faire est d'écrire les données dans un tube et d'utiliser une boîte à outils de gestion d'événements pour surveiller les événements d'entrée-sortie. Une autre manière est d'envoyer un signal. Ces deux méthodes sont lentes, et dans le cas d'un tube, ne sont pas non plus asynchrones — cela n'interrompra pas un interpréteur Perl en exécution.
Ce module implémente des notifications asynchrones qui permettent d'envoyer un signal pendant l'exécution de code Perl à partir d'un autre processus, de façon asynchrone, et parfois même sans utiliser un seul appel système.
Autres paquets associés à libasync-interrupt-perl
|
|
|
|
-
- dep: libc6 (>= 2.28)
- bibliothèque C GNU : bibliothèques partagées
un paquet virtuel est également fourni par libc6-udeb
-
- dep: libcommon-sense-perl
- module that implements some sane defaults for Perl programs
-
- dep: perl (>= 5.40.0-6)
- langage de rapports et d'extractions pratiques de Larry Wall
-
- dep: perlapi-5.40.0
- paquet virtuel fourni par perl-base
Télécharger libasync-interrupt-perl
Architecture | Version | Taille du paquet | Espace occupé une fois installé | Fichiers |
---|---|---|---|---|
sparc64 (portage non officiel) | 1.26-1+b6 | 31,5 ko | 1 087,0 ko | [liste des fichiers] |